Mac 安装和卸载 Mysql5.7.11 的方法
安装
去http://www.mysql.com/downloads/, 选择最下方的MySQL Community Edition,点击MySQL Community Server的download, 下载DGM Archive版本。
下载好之后发现只有一个dmg主文件,貌似5.7之前的版本会有多个安装文件。
点开这个文件,逐步安装,注意在成功的时候会弹出提示框,给出临时密码,一定要记住,一定要记住,一定要记住!!!! 如果没找到,请桌面右拉看notifications。
安装成功后,到偏好设置最后一行找到mysql,启动mysql(选择start).
下面就好进行临时密码的修改了:
打开terminal, 一般mysql会默认存在local目录下,所以输入
cd /usr/local/mysql/bin/
执行以下命令:
./mysqladmin –u root –p password
然后会提示输入密码,输入你的临时密码,成功之后会要求输入新密码,将会出现的代码如下
New password:
Confirm new password:
然后出现Since password will be sent to server in plain text, use ssl connection to ensure password safety.这代表已经修改成功啦。
然后使用新的密码登陆mysql,
cd /usr/local/mysql/bin/
./mysqladmin –u root –p
然后输入新密码就好啦!
卸载!!!
在安装过程中出现各种各样的问题,导致我多次重复安装,最终一团糟。后来知道安装新的需要把之前的mysql删除,一个文件都不能留。所以从网上找到了完整代码,保留在此。
侵权删~~~ 偶是遵纪守法的好孩子
sudo rm /usr/local/mysql
sudo rm -rf /usr/local/mysql*
sudo rm -rf /Library/StartupItems/MySQLCOM
sudo rm -rf /Library/PreferencePanes/My*
rm -rf ~/Library/PreferencePanes/My*
sudo rm -rf /Library/Receipts/mysql*
sudo rm -rf /Library/Receipts/MySQL*
sudo rm -rf /var/db/receipts/com.mysql.
调用vim /etc/hostconfig,删除 MYSQLCOM=-YES-这一行。
Tips: 我貌似没有删干净,所以在finder-Go-gotofolder之下输入/usr/local,看有没有重复的mysql文件,有的话就彻底删除。
对了,下载完之后local里面会有一个带有你下载的版本名字的mysql文件夹和一个Mysql快捷方式,我们都是调用这个快捷方式的。
相关推荐
-
MAC下MYSQL5.7.17连接不上的问题及解决办法
MAC下MYSQL5.7.17无法连接的问题,下载安装完SQLBench_community 6.3.9后新建MYSQL CONNECTIONS根本连接不上,提示为密码错. 具体表现为:Access denied for user 'root'@'localhost' (using password: YES) Step1: 苹果->系统偏好设置->最下边点MySQL 在弹出页面中 关闭mysql服务(点击stop mysql server); Step2: 进入终端输入:cd /usr/lo
-
Mac下安装mysql5.7 完整步骤(图文详解)
最近使用Mac系统,准备搭建一套本地web服务器环境.因为Mac系统自带PHP和apach,但是没有自带mysql,所以要手动去安装mysql,本次安装mysql最新版5.7.17. 1.官网下载 MySQL v5.7官方正式版下载地址:http://www.jb51.net/softs/451120.html 点击上面的地址,会看到如下图的页面.你可能不知道该下载哪一个,我下载的是最后一个,就是图中标注红色的那个按钮,为什么?因为它是dmg文件,傻瓜式安装,一路确认就可以. 点进去之后,你会看
-
mac os10.12安装mysql5.7.18教程
搜了全网都是各种坑,没能解决我的问题.最后自己琢磨出来了. 安装好以后,会弹出临时密码 ,copy住.如果手点快了,在通知栏还有一次机会,通知栏的就只能看着手打了.如果通知栏也没了,最快方法只能重装了.(重装前先卸载干净) 然后打开控制台输入mysql 会提示 command not found,然后输入 alias mysql=/usr/local/mysql/bin/mysql alias mysqladmin=/usr/local/mysql/bin/mysqladmin 起个别名,注意关
-
Mac下MySQL5.7忘记root密码的解决方法
mysql5.7忘记root密码的操作步骤: 1. 在系统偏好设置中停止MySQL服务. 2.执行命令以安全模式启动MySQL: cd /usr/local/mysql/bin sudo ./mysqld_safe --skip-grant-tables 3.新打开一个命令行窗口,在MySQL中执行 update mysql.user set authentication_string=PASSWORD('你的密码') where User='root'; FLUSH PRIVILEGES; 注
-
Mac系统下MySql下载MySQL5.7及详细安装图解
一.在浏览器当中输入以下地址 https://dev.mysql.com/downloads/mysql/ 二.进入以下界面:直接点击下面位置 ,选择跳过登录 点过这后直接下载. 三.下载完成后, 直接双击打开,弹出以下界面,再继续点击即可 下面 一直点继续,和正学安装其它软件一样 四.启动MySQL 安装完毕后,到设置当中查看以下选项,如果里面有MySQL说明已经安装成功 点击后, 启动MySQL 五.修改数据库密码 启动完成后,打开终端 aliasmysql=/usr/local/mysql
-
Mac OS10.11下mysql5.7.12 安装配置方法图文教程
Mac OS10.11安装和配置MySQL,主要是图,步骤我简单说明一下. 首先访问mysql官网并下载安装程序,当然在下载之前你需要线注册下账号. 网站地址:MySQL下载页面,下载两个安装程序:MySQL Community Server.MySQL Workbench. MySQL Community Server 点击进入下载页面,在页面最下方,有下载选项,请确认选择的平台是Mac OS X,然后下载下图用红框划出的安装包.下载时需要登录帐号. 下载后运行,直接运行mysql.pkg,在
-
MAC下Mysql5.7.10版本修改root密码的方法
首先 跳过权限表模式启动MySQL:mysqld --skip-grant-tables & 从现在开始,你将踏入第一个坑,如果你使用网上到处贴的 错误修改方法: mysql> UPDATE mysql.user SET authentication_string=PASSWORD('your_new_password') WHERE User='root'; (注意,5.7之后password改成了authentication_string)那么恭喜你,你修改成功了,但是你会发现当你使用n
-
Mac 安装和卸载 Mysql5.7.11 的方法
安装 去http://www.mysql.com/downloads/, 选择最下方的MySQL Community Edition,点击MySQL Community Server的download, 下载DGM Archive版本. 下载好之后发现只有一个dmg主文件,貌似5.7之前的版本会有多个安装文件. 点开这个文件,逐步安装,注意在成功的时候会弹出提示框,给出临时密码,一定要记住,一定要记住,一定要记住!!!! 如果没找到,请桌面右拉看notifications. 安装成功后,到偏好设
-
64位Win10系统安装Mysql5.7.11的方法(案例详解)
最近在装了64位Win10系统的mac book笔记本上用mysql-installer-community-5.7.11.0安装Mysql5.7.11,在配置mysql server时老是卡住,报错.(在别的PC相同windows系统,自动安装没问题),决定手动安装,依然问题多多,最后的成功安装案例如下: 一.准备安装软件 1.mysql.com下载mysql-5.7.11-win32.zip 2.mysql-workbench-community-6.3.6-win32.msi 3.vcre
-
在Mac下彻底卸载node和npm的方法
用了nvm进行node版本的管理,还是很方便的,各个版本切换自由切换,但是nvm安装的node是在~/.nvm下的,和之前安装的不在一起,有点儿强迫症的我,就想把之前的给卸载了 homebrew安装的 直接一条命令 brew uninstall node 官网下载pkg安装包的 一条命令 sudo rm -rf /usr/local/{bin/{node,npm},lib/node_modules/npm,lib/node,share/man/*/node.*} 其他路子安装的 搞一个脚本,把需
-
mac安装pytorch及系统的numpy更新方法
安装Pytorch 在pytorch官网上选择相应选项,我的是OS X, pip, python2.7, none CUDA. (之所以用python2.7只是觉得现在还有好多代码用2.7写的,用3+版本经常会由于语法更新而报错.而且用3+的话sublime还要配下python3 的building system......) 打开terminal,输入: sudo pip install http://download.pytorch.org/whl/torch-0.3.0.post4-cp2
-
linux ubuntu中安装、卸载和删除python-igraph的方法教程
前言 最近在学习python-igraph,发现其实学习一种全新的语言看官方的文档是真的很有帮助,这次我的大部分python代码的完成都是靠着igraph官方的API文档. 官方API:http://pythonhosted.org/python-igraph/igraph.Graph-class.html 本文将给大家详细介绍关于在linux ubuntu安装.卸载和删除python-igraph的相关内容,分享出来供大家参考学习,下面话不多说了,来一起看看详细的介绍吧. 一.如何在Ubunt
-
Mac下完全卸载干净Android Studio的方法
本文实例为大家分享了Mac完整卸载Android Studio的方法,供大家参考,具体内容如下 第一种:卸载Android Studio的方法 1.卸载Android Studio,在终端(terminal)执行以下命令: rm -Rf /Applications/Android\ Studio.app rm -Rf ~/Library/Preferences/AndroidStudio* rm ~/Library/Preferences/com.google.android.studio.pl
-
MySql5.7.11编译安装及修改root密码的方法小结
推荐阅读: Mysql5.7忘记root密码及mysql5.7修改root密码的方法 Mac 安装和卸载 Mysql5.7.11 的方法 系统是cenos6.7 64位的,默认mysql5.7.11下载到/usr/local/src,安装目录在/app/local/mysql目录下,mysql数据放置目录/app/local/data.mysql从5.1后采用cmake方式编译安装,所以要先编译安装cmake工具,也可以采用yum方式安装cmake.从mysql5.7开始编译安装需要boost库
-
Windows版Mysql5.6.11的安装与配置教程
注册了oracle的登录名:10402852@qq.com 密码:dsideal******** 后面的*号是王卓常用的密码,但是是大写的,因为ORACLE的密码机制要求严格. WINDOWS版下载地址: 真实下载地址:http://cdn.mysql.com/Downloads/MySQLInstaller/mysql-installer-community-5.6.11.0.msi LINUX下载地址: 源码安装选择"Source Code"下拉菜单,在出来的列表里选最后一个&q
-
Mysql5.7.11在windows10上的安装与配置(解压版)
第一步 my-default.ini 添加配置: #绑定IPv4和3306端 bind-address = 127.0.0.1 port = 3306 # 设置mysql的安装目 basedir= E:\mysql # 设置mysql数据库的数据的存放目 datadir=E:\mysql\data # 允许最大连接数 max_connections=200 #设置默认字符集为utf8 default-character-set=utf8 第二步 右击我的电脑–>属性–>高级–>环境变量,
-
Mysql5.7.11绿色版安装教程图文详解
Mysql5.7.11绿色版安装教程图文详解如下所示: 1.解压mysql-5.7.11压缩包到想要存放的磁盘文件夹中: 2.在文件夹中新建一个data文件夹和新建一个my.ini文件,并配置my.ini文件 my.ini文件内容:关键点为配置Mysql文件夹中的data目录及存储根目录 3.在我的电脑--属性--高级系统设置--环境变量--配置path变量: 变量值为: 4.使用管理员身份打开cmd.exe程序 注意:如果未使用管理员身份打开的cmd.exe,在mysql安装过程中会出现 --
随机推荐
- PHP设计模式 注册表模式
- Javascript Jquery 遍历Json的实现代码
- JS基于MSClass和setInterval实现ajax定时采集信息并滚动显示的方法
- js 获取今天以及过去日期
- js form 验证函数 当前比较流行的错误提示
- Nodejs极简入门教程(一):模块机制
- js创建子窗口并且回传值示例代码
- Python批量修改文本文件内容的方法
- 浅谈解决360兼容模式浏览器的方法
- javascript中加var和不加var的区别 你真的懂吗
- 详解 Nginx 负载均衡和反向代理配置和优化
- 如何增加大家的google广告收入
- java json不生成null或者空字符串属性(详解)
- thinkphp5使用bootstrapvalidator进行异步验证邮箱的示例
- vue设计一个倒计时秒杀的组件详解
- Java使用Redis的方法实例分析
- 利用pyinstaller打包exe文件的基本教程
- 解决pyqt5中QToolButton无法使用的问题
- python批量修改图片尺寸,并保存指定路径的实现方法
- php使用curl模拟浏览器表单上传文件或者图片的方法